I don't have a nitrogen burst system so I can only relate my observations, having seen and experimented with many sheet film developing techniques and systems over the years - including several gas burst systems. Most systems and manual techniques are lousy as far as uniformity goes, including techniques that seem at first glance/thought like they should work well. Jobo expert drums produce - by far - the best results. I'm working on trying to duplicate those results manually since I don't have a Jobo machine.
If you are satisfied with your burst system, that's cool. I'm only suggesting to someone who hasn't yet invested in building one, that there are better processing options if one is ok forgoing the engineering coolness.
